Leader of Opposition Betty Ochan claims FDC will not field Besigye in forthcoming election

William Kasoba by William Kasoba
July 18, 2020
in 2021 Elections
Reading Time: 2 mins read
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Recently reports have been making rounds that Uganda’s strongest opposition party Forum for Democratic (FDC) was in talks with their ‘usual’ candidate Dr Kizza Besigye trying to push him run again against President Yoweri Museveni in the forthcoming election.

In a shocking disclosure, Leader of opposition in Parliament Aol Betty Ochan has said that FDC will not field Besigye as their presidential flag bearer in the upcoming election.

Ochan claimed that with FDC not being a one man’s party, Besigye has always told the party leadership how he wants to create room for another person to express interest in the position.

The four-time presidential aspirant is yet to officially express his intentions to stand against Museveni for the fifth time. However, our sources in the FDC reveal saying; “If not Besigye then who else?”

Similarly, Besigye has always hit back at those who ask him to quit the struggle. He says no one invited him into struggle so he will fight until Uganda is liberated.

Last month, People’s Government led by Besigye and Bobi Wine’s People Power Movement announced a coalition dubbed United Forces of Change and they hinted on working together in the upcoming election.
